How is the authenticity of an advertising services contract verified in the Dominican Republic?

The authenticity of an advertising services contract in the Dominican Republic is verified through the parties involved and can be supported by a notary public. These contracts must contain details about the advertising services to be provided, the media to be used, the performance period and the agreed compensation. Signing the contract and obtaining authenticated copies are common practices to ensure that the agreed terms are met. Authentication of advertising services contracts is important for both advertising agencies and advertisers

What is the impact of food safety regulations on companies in the food sector in Bolivia and how can they comply?

Food safety regulations in Bolivia are essential to guarantee the quality and safety of food products. Companies must comply with regulations on hygiene, labeling and quality control. Implementing food safety management systems, testing regularly, and maintaining accurate records are key steps to complying with these regulations. Compliance is not only legally mandatory, but also protects public health and the company's reputation.

How are temporary hiring practices regulated and what are the rights of temporary workers in Colombia?

Temporary hiring in Colombia is regulated to protect the rights of temporary workers. These workers have similar rights to permanent employees, including benefits and fair working conditions. Employers must comply with regulations on contract duration and cannot abuse temporary employment to avoid job responsibilities.
